⨠Key Features & Product Details:
Weatherproof Protection: Built with Ariatâs proprietary DRYShield⢠waterproof construction to keep your feet completely dry in rain, mud, or slush.
Premium Materials: Luxurious waterproof suede upper paired with rich full-grain leather contrast accents at the heel counter and pull tabs.
All-Day Comfort: Features ATSÂŽ technology for ergonomic stability and support on uneven terrain, plus a removable All-Day Cushioning moisture-wicking insole.
Lightweight Heavy-Duty Sole: Chunky, rugged lug sole made from 100% recyclable SMARTLITE⢠TPUâgives you a bold, trendy look without the heavy, clunky weight.
Easy On/Off: Classic elastic twin-gore side panels and durable leather back pull tab featuring signature Ariat hardware details.
Style Profile: Perfectly blends rugged Gorpcore utility with a refined country-equestrian aesthetic. Ideal for everything from outdoor trail walks and rainy commutes to styling with casual denim or dresses.
